What Are Dry Storage Containers?
Dry storage containers are large, standardized shipping containers created to save non-perishable items. These containers are generally made of corrugated steel, making them durable and weather-resistant. They are available in various sizes, with the most common being 20-foot and 40-foot containers. These containers are particularly popular among services for their capability to assist in the storage and transportation of goods around the world.

Maintenance Tips for Dry Storage Containers
To ensure longevity and continued performance of dry storage containers, routine maintenance is important. Here are important maintenance pointers:

Regular Inspections: Check for rust, structural integrity, and seal conditions to prevent leakages.

Clean and Organize: Maintain cleanliness and organization inside the container to avoid insect invasions.

Secure Locks: Regularly check and oil the locking mechanisms to keep them working properly.

Placement: Ensure the container is put on steady ground to prevent moving or sinking.

Q3: Are dry storage containers waterproof?A3: While they are weather-resistant, they are not entirely waterproof. Therefore, it is suggested to use wetness absorbers for delicate products. Q4: How do I transport a dry storage container?A4: Transportation can typically be attained by flatbed trucks or shipping trailers, but it's best to work with specialists experienced in handling containers.
